نايف - م قام بنشر أغسطس 3, 2017 قام بنشر أغسطس 3, 2017 (معدل) السلام عليكم أنا أستخدم خاصية البجث كثيرا , و هي خاصية متعبة - البحث ثم عرض النتائج ثم المسح و اعادة البحث عن كلمة أحرى ثم خطر ببالي ان أسأل هل يمكن وضع كلمات البحث بمربع البحث _التكستبوكس _ ثم البحث عن كل الكلمات باستخدام أمر Split(TextBox.Text, vbCrLf) ثم بحثت بالموقع و بالنت و حاولت كثيرا و لم أصل لحل هل يمكن المساعدة بحلول مقترحة بحث بدلالة كلمتين.rar تم تعديل أغسطس 3, 2017 بواسطه نايف - م
أفضل إجابة ياسر خليل أبو البراء قام بنشر أغسطس 3, 2017 أفضل إجابة قام بنشر أغسطس 3, 2017 وعليكم السلام أخي الكريم نايف جرب الكود التالي (مع استبدال اسم ورقة العمل في الكود باسم ورقة العمل لديك حيث أنني أحبذ التعامل مع أسماء أوراق العمل باللغة الإنجليزية) Private Sub CommandButton1_Click() Dim m As Integer Dim r As Integer Dim t As Integer Dim i As Integer Dim x As Variant ListBox1.Clear With Sheets("Sheet1") m = .Cells(.Rows.Count, 1).End(xlUp).Row x = Split(TextBox1.Text, vbCrLf) If UBound(x) = -1 Then Exit Sub For i = LBound(x) To UBound(x) For r = 2 To m If .Cells(r, 2) Like x(i) & "*" Then ListBox1.AddItem ListBox1.List(t, 0) = .Cells(r, 1) ListBox1.List(t, 1) = .Cells(r, 2) t = t + 1 End If Next r Next i End With End Sub 2
نايف - م قام بنشر أغسطس 3, 2017 الكاتب قام بنشر أغسطس 3, 2017 تمام و هو المطلوب بارك الله بك و بأعمالك شكرا جزيلا لسرعة و دقة الأستجابة
ياسر خليل أبو البراء قام بنشر أغسطس 3, 2017 قام بنشر أغسطس 3, 2017 الحمد لله أن تم المطلوب على خير والحمد لله الذي بنعمته تتم الصالحات
الردود الموصى بها
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.